The San Diego Summit

is a unique forum for professionals across all disciplines and philosophies to gather for in-depth exchange of current information on all facets of violence, abuse and trauma prevention, intervention, treatment, and research. We are one of the very few events that include researchers, practitioners, advocates, survivors, and front-line workers from all disciplines to share information, discuss controversial issues, and engage in difficult dialogues. Evident in our uniquely comprehensive programming, the Summit focuses on linking research, practice, policy and advocacy to promote violence-free living for all. Opportunities for networking, continuing education, specialty certifications, and more make this an event you don’t want to miss.

Summit Tracks

1. Adolescent Survivors of Abuse and Trauma

2. Child and Adolescent Maltreatment/Adverse Childhood Experiences
(ACEs)

3. Criminal & Civil Justice Systems

4. Grief, Loss, & Healing After Disaster Trauma

5. Historical Trauma, Systemic Trauma, and Marginalized Populations

6. Intimate Partner Violence: Offenders

7. Intimate Partner Violence: Victims/Survivors

8. Labor & Sex Trafficking

9. Primary Prevention/Early Intervention

10. Sexual Victimization

11. Trauma Among Military Personnel, Veterans, First Responders &
Their Families

12. Trauma in General

Areas of Emphasis: Domestic Violence, Child Abuse, Ethics and Professional Development, Cultural Issues, Aging / Long Term Care, Substance Use Suicide Assessment and Prevention.

Performances

 

Mariachi Juvenil Herencia Michoacana

Mariachi Juvenil Herencia Michoacana was founded in August 2016, in the city of Costa Mesa. We have competed in many competitions in different categories. Our last competition was at the Mariachi Nationals on August 4th, 2023, where we placed 1st place. We have worked with several Hispanic artists like, Ana Barbara, Steven Sandoval, and a few professional mariachis like Mariachi Sol de Mexico. We were part of a halftime show for the LA Chargers along with Mariachi Sol de Mexico and Mariachi Reina de Los Angeles. We are committed to teaching people about our culture through our music.
